KMRG, LLC is hiring a full-time Staffing & Recruitment Specialist in Washington, D.C. to deliver expert federal staffing and recruitment support to the Executive Office for United States Attorneys (EOUSA). About the Role As a Staffing & Recruitment Specialist with KMRG, LLC, you will partner with EOUSA stakeholders to guide federal hiring from start to finish. Based in Washington, D.C., this on-site position centers on advising teams through recruitment processes and making sure every staffing action is handled correctly, promptly, and in line with the federal regulations that govern public-sector hiring. Key Responsibilities Provide hands-on support for federal hiring actions across the EOUSA staffing lifecycle. Advise managers and personnel teams on recruitment procedures and best practices. Help ensure staffing activities are completed accurately, efficiently, and on schedule. Confirm that recruitment work remains consistent with applicable federal laws, regulations, and policies. Coordinate with stakeholders to keep hiring initiatives moving smoothly and transparently. Qualifications Demonstrated experience as a Staffing & Recruitment Specialist or in a comparable federal staffing or recruitment role. Working knowledge of federal hiring processes and the regulations that shape them. Strong attention to detail and the ability to manage staffing actions with accuracy and speed. Clear communication and advisory skills for guiding hiring teams through recruitment steps. Availability to work full-time on-site in Washington, D.C. About KMRG, LLC KMRG, LLC supports federal agencies with specialized staffing and recruitment services. Joining the team means contributing directly to the mission of the Executive Office for United States Attorneys by helping build a capable, well-staffed federal workforce.
